da cassino: The right-back is out of contract with the Craven Cottage outfit this summer and could be tempted to try his luck at the senior level of the Premier League.
The former Tottenham Hotspur academy graduate has been highlighted by current boss David Moyes as someone he wants to bring into the club.

Would Fredericks be a good addition?
The Irons are currently struggling for depth at the back, with the likes of Pablo Zabaleta and Sam Byram currently filling in at that position.
Both have found this season difficult to impress, with the Argentine playing the way his age would suggest at times.
The Hammers have also added Patrice Evra to the ranks on the left-hand side, however, another ageing figure would be a concern for most of the West Ham fans.
Fredericks would add some youth to the side and has performed well for the Championship outfit so far, however, he is thought to be happy at Craven Cottage, despite no new contract being offered at the moment.
